Sahih al-Bukhari is widely regarded as the most authentic collection of hadith in Sunni Islam. Compiled by Imam Muhammad ibn Ismail al-Bukhari (810–870 CE), it contains approximately 7,275 hadith selected from over 600,000 narrations. The Urdu translation presented here is in the public domain.
